LONDON — Specialist agency Broadcast Revolution has hired 20-year BBC veteran journalist Mike Young to help brands engage audiences through video, digital media and podcasts.

Young, who joins the agency as a consultant, has been a BBC journalist, producer and presenter on shows including BBC Radio 5 live Breakfast, Drivetime and Morning Reports, BBC Radio Nottingham, the Smart Consumer podcast and most recently at BBC Radio 4’s You & Yours.

Phil Caplin, the former director of broadcast at Good Relations, who launched Broadcast Revolution in 2019, said: “Through the pandemic, the scale and demand for original insight and content from brands has gone through the roof.

“Mike’s expertise as a broadcast veteran will allow us to drive forward our agenda and mission to put a broadcast strategy first, facilitate a genuine two-way relationship between brands and broadcasters and produce high quality video and podcasts to drive engagement for brands online.”

Young added: “There is such a huge opportunity for brands to play a pivotal role in providing authentic and relevant insight to media and consumers about the matters that are shaping our society most. I can’t wait to get started and share my expertise with Broadcast Revolution’s clients.”

The appointment follows a number of recent hires at Broadcast Revolution, including Rebecca McAree, who joined last month from Brazen PR in Manchester.

The agency has also stepped up its Broadcast For Good initiative throughout the pandemic, and has so far donated the equivalent of £115,000 pro bono hours to charities including British Red Cross and Cats Protection.
